Cryptography and Function Fields,We study the thermodynamic behaviour of spin and gauge systems in the presence of a quenched external random field. In particular, we show that for Z (2) spin gauge theory in two space dimensions, the random field destroys the ordered phase and thus leads to a shift in the lower critical dimension, just as found for the corresponding Ising model.作者: 贊成你 時(shí)間: 2025-3-23 11:55 作者: 流出 時(shí)間: 2025-3-23 17:46
